public abstract class AbstractDict extends java.lang.Object implements Dictionary
Dictionary.MV
限定符和类型 | 字段和说明 |
---|---|
protected Condition |
condition |
EMPTY_DICT, XML_TAG
构造器和说明 |
---|
AbstractDict() |
限定符和类型 | 方法和说明 |
---|---|
void |
analyzeCorrelative(CalculatorProvider calculator,
ExTool exTool,
ColumnRow currentCr)
记录数据字典中使用的相关格子,当格子值改变后,形态值需要相应做改变
|
java.lang.Object |
clone() |
java.lang.String[] |
dependence(CalculatorProvider ca)
获取当前对象对参数的依赖关系
|
boolean |
equals(java.lang.Object obj) |
Condition |
getCondition()
获取数据字典所使用的条件
|
void |
readXML(XMLableReader reader)
读取子节点,应该会被XMLableReader.readXMLObject()调用多次
|
void |
reset()
重设数据字典
|
void |
setCondition(Condition condition)
设置数据字典所使用的条件
|
java.lang.String |
toString()
当前对象的字符串展示
|
void |
writeXML(XMLPrintWriter writer)
Write XML.
|
entrys, entrys, get
protected Condition condition
public Condition getCondition()
getCondition
在接口中 Dictionary
public void setCondition(Condition condition)
setCondition
在接口中 Dictionary
condition
- 条件public void analyzeCorrelative(CalculatorProvider calculator, ExTool exTool, ColumnRow currentCr)
analyzeCorrelative
在接口中 Dictionary
calculator
- 算子exTool
- 格子间关系计算工具currentCr
- 当前行列public void readXML(XMLableReader reader)
XMLReadable
readXML
在接口中 XMLReadable
reader
- XML读取对象XMLableReader
public void writeXML(XMLPrintWriter writer)
XMLWriter
public java.lang.String[] dependence(CalculatorProvider ca)
dependence
在接口中 DependenceProvider
ca
- 当前线程的算子public void reset()
reset
在接口中 Dictionary
public java.lang.String toString()
toString
在类中 java.lang.Object
public boolean equals(java.lang.Object obj)
equals
在类中 java.lang.Object
public java.lang.Object clone() throws java.lang.CloneNotSupportedException
clone
在接口中 FCloneable
clone
在类中 java.lang.Object
java.lang.CloneNotSupportedException
- 如果克隆失败则抛出此异常